开发O2O平台:掌握移动端应用关键

随着移动互联网的快速发展,人们的生活和工作方式也在不断发生变化。O2O(在线本地化)平台作为一种新兴的商业模式,正逐渐被人们所接受。而要开发一个成功的O2O平台,移动端应用的开发是至关重要的。本文将探讨如何掌握移动端应用的关键,以及开发O2O平台所需要的技术和流程。

一、移动端应用开发的关键

1. 用户体验

移动端应用的用户体验是吸引用户使用的重要因素。因此,在开发应用的过程中,需要注重用户界面、交互逻辑、响应速度等方面的设计。例如,在应用中加入地图、列表等查看功能,使得用户更加方便地查找周边的商家。

2. 安全性

移动端应用涉及到用户的个人信息和支付等敏感信息,因此在开发过程中需要注重安全性。需要确保用户信息的保护,防止用户的个人信息被泄露。同时,需要确保应用中不存在恶意代码,防止黑客攻击和数据泄露等问题。

3. 可扩展性

随着应用的不断发展,需要不断对其进行扩展和升级,以满足用户不断变化的需求。因此,在开发移动端应用的过程中,需要注重其可扩展性。例如,通过模块化的设计,将不同的功能模块进行分离,方便开发者进行独立开发和升级。

二、开发O2O平台所需的技术和流程

1. 前端技术

前端技术是开发O2O平台最重要的一环。目前,主流的前端技术有HTML、CSS、JavaScript、Vue.js等。其中,HTML、CSS为基础,JavaScript负责实现页面的交互效果,Vue.js是一种轻量级的前端框架,非常适合开发O2O平台。

2. 后端技术

后端技术也是O2O平台开发不可或缺的一环。目前,主流的后端技术有Java、Python、Node.js等。其中,Java是最为广泛应用的一种语言,具有性能稳定的特点。对于O2O平台而言,需要考虑用户、商家、订单等数据的存储和处理,因此,需要使用Java技术来应对这些需求。

3. 移动端应用开发流程

移动端应用开发需要注重用户体验、安全性和可扩展性。因此,需要将应用拆分成不同的模块,以实现各模块的独立开发、升级和维护。同时,需要通过敏捷开发、迭代开发等方式,不断优化和升级应用,以满足用户的需求。

三、结论

开发O2O平台需要注重移动端应用的开发,尤其是用户体验、安全性和可扩展性。同时,需要注重前端技术、后端技术以及移动端应用开发流程等方面的技术,以开发出高性能、稳定、安全的O2O平台。